How To Fix /SCWM/QUI_WRKST043 - Elements belonging to inspection document &1 were only part. decided


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SCWM/QUI_WRKST -

  • Message number: 043

  • Message text: Elements belonging to inspection document &1 were only part. decided

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SCWM/QUI_WRKST043 - Elements belonging to inspection document &1 were only part. decided ?

    The SAP error message /SCWM/QUI_WRKST043 indicates that there is an issue related to the inspection document in the context of Quality Management (QM) within the Extended Warehouse Management (EWM) module. The message states that elements belonging to the specified inspection document were only partially decided, which means that not all items or elements associated with the inspection document have been fully processed or evaluated.

    Cause:

    1. Partial Decision: The inspection document has been created, but not all items have been fully evaluated or decided upon. This could happen if some items are still under inspection or if the decision process was interrupted.
    2. Incomplete Data: There may be missing data or incomplete entries in the inspection document that prevent it from being fully processed.
    3. System Configuration: There could be configuration issues in the EWM or QM settings that affect how inspection documents are handled.

    Solution:

    1. Review Inspection Document: Check the inspection document referenced in the error message. Ensure that all items have been evaluated and that decisions have been made for each item.
    2. Complete the Decision Process: If there are items that are still pending, complete the decision process for those items. This may involve entering results, making quality decisions, or updating statuses.
    3. Check for Errors: Look for any errors or warnings in the inspection document that may indicate why certain items were not fully decided.
    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for guidance on handling inspection documents and resolving related issues.
    5. System Configuration: If the issue persists, review the configuration settings in both EWM and QM to ensure they are set up correctly for handling inspection documents.
